Algae, singular alga, members of a group of predominantly aquatic photosynthetic organisms of the kingdom Protista.Algae have many types of life cycles, and they range in size from microscopic Micromonas species to giant kelps that reach 60 metres (200 feet) in length. Large blooms of planktonic algae grow in response to excessive nutrients (phosphorus and nitrogen) in the pond water from barnyards, crop fields, septic systems, lawns, and golf courses. Derived from the Greek words phyto (plant) and plankton (made to wander or drift), phytoplankton are microscopic organisms that live in watery environments, both salty and fresh..
